Eligibility Criteria in B.Tech. Electrical Engineering

There are some points for eligibility in B.Tech. Electrical Engineering which are given below:

  • It is required for all the candidates to passed intermediate class with a minimum of 50% marks.
  • The applicants must have studied majorly PCM (physics, chemistry, mathematics) as main subjects in intermediate.
  • No age limit is applicable for B.Tech. Electrical Engineering.

Syllabus for B.Tech. Electrical Engineering

For First Year:

Professional Communication

Engineering Drawing

Fundamentals of Mechanical Engineering

Engineering Mathematics – 1

Engineering Physics – 1

Engineering Mathematics – 2

Engineering Chemistry

Fundamentals of Electrical Engineering

Technical Communication

Fundamentals of Electronics Engineering

Environmental Studies

Fundamentals of Computer

For Second Year:

Mechanics of Solids

Engineering Mathematics – 3

Signals and Systems

Electrical Measurements

Applied Thermodynamics

Circuit Theory

Digital Circuits

Managerial Economics

Data Structures

Electrical Machines – 1

Analogue Circuits

Numerical and Statistical Methods

For Third Year:

Control Systems – 2

Computer Application in Power Systems

Microprocessors and Computer Organisation

Electric Power Generation

Control Systems – 1

Power Systems

Field Theory

Microprocessor Based System

Power Electronics

Electrical Machines – 2

Digital Signal Processing

Instrumentation

 

For Fourth Year:

Electrical Drives

Special Purpose Electrical Machines

High Voltage Engineering

Switchgear and Protection

Electrical Machines and Power System Designs

Communication Engineering

Advanced Power Electronics

Opto-Electronics

Mine Electrical Technology

Operation Research

Power Plant Instrumentation and Control

Major Project

Electric Transportation

Expected Average Salary

The salary package for B.Tech. candidate (Electrical Engineer) is totally depends on the skills and ability of the candidate.  The private companies mostly offers the basic pay ranges from 250000/- to 500000/- P.A. (Per Annum).

Admission process for B.Tech. Electrical Engineering

The admission process for B.Tech. Electrical Engineering is as follows:

Admission Process for IITs

JEE Advanced and JoSAA Counselling

Admission for NITs, IIITs and GFTIs

JEE Main and JoSAA Counselling

Admission in Private Engineering Colleges

State-Level Entrance Exam/ Direct Admission

Admission in Private Deemed Universities

Deemed University Entrance Exam/ Direct Admission
